Primitive neuroectodermal tumor (PNET) is a small round cell neoplasm that develops in children and young adults. The identification of immunoreactivity for CD99 is important for diagnosis of PNET. But, there have been no reports that PNET is immunoreactive for CD34. Therefore, we report a case of PNET developed in a 26 year-old man, which occurred primarily in the bone marrow. He was presented with hypercalcemia and pancytopenia. Bone marrow aspiration biopsy revealed that tumor cells were composed of round cells with hyperchromatic unclear chromatin and minimal eosinophilic cytoplasm. Rosette formations were occasionally observed. The tumor cells were diffusely immunopositive for CD99 and CD34, while they were immunonegative for vimentin, neuron specific enolase, cytokeratin, desmin, leukocyte common antigen, synaptophysin. He was treated with chemotherapy after general medical supportive care, and still alive during the 6 months of follow-up.

Myelofibrosis is a myeloproliferative neoplasm characterized by abnormal bone marrow megakaryocyte proliferation with reticulin and collagen fibrosis, leukoerythroblastosis, anemia, increased level of serum lactate dehydrogenase and splenomegaly. Myelofibrosis associated with malignant lymphoma is rare and survival rates appear to have been poor. Herein, we describe our experience in a patient who remained in complete remission with high-dose therapy (HDT) with autologous peripheral blood stem cell transplantation (PBSCT) for ALK-negative ALCL presenting with rapidly progressing myelofibrosis. Human bone marrow contain two kinds of stem cells. One is hematopoietic stem cell, and the other is multipotential mesenchymal stem cells which are capable of differentiating into a number of mesenchymal cell lineages. These mesenchymal stem cells are shown to secrete hematopoietic cytokines and support hematopietic progenitors in vitro. Animal models suggest that the transplantation of healthy stromal elements, including mesenchymal stem cells, may enhance the ability of the bone marrow microenvironment to support hematopoiesis after stem cell transplantation. Therefore, We hypothesized that cotransplantation of hematopoietic stem cells and mesenchymal stem cells after high dose chemotherapy would facilitate engraftment of hematopietic stem cells and reduce complications caused by delayed engraftments. And we investigated the safety, feasibility, side effects and hematopoietic effects of in vitro-expanded mesenchymal stem cells in hematologic malignancies receiving allogeneic peripheral stem cell transplantation.
